North East CA in Newcastle upon Tyne is seeking a Principal Transport Planner – Active Travel to lead strategic development of walking and cycling networks across the region. You will manage a diverse program, ensuring active travel is integrated into regional growth.

With a focus on inclusive design, you'll work with local authorities and stakeholders to transform spaces and lives. We encourage applications from diverse backgrounds to enhance our inclusive environment.
